Description
These lateral-cut tumblers bring a crisp, faceted geometry to everyday drinking. The angled cut pattern catches ambient light at the table — visible enough to make an impression, restrained enough to work with any dinnerware. Each glass holds 315 ml (10.6 fl oz), well sized for water, juice, a cocktail, or a measure of whiskey, and the sleek cylindrical form offers a comfortable, confident grip. Crafted from durable glass and sold as a coordinated set of four, they complete a table setting on their own or layer into your existing glassware.
